New £45,000 Jaecoo 8 is brand's largest, plushest car yet
Wednesday, Mar 11, 2026 12:00 PM
Jaecoo 8 7 Six- or seven-seat plug-in hybrid SUV takes Jaecoo into new territory; has 83-mile electric range

Jaecoo has confirmed its flagship 8 SUV will arrive here in May, marking its expansion into more premium territory following the success of the smaller 5 and 7.

Featuring curvier, sleeker styling compared to the Chinese brand's existing models, the plug-in hybrid 8 will arrive in the UK with two trim levels: Luxury at £45,500 and Executive at £47,500.

Both are equipped with the Super Hybrid System (SHS) that's also used by other Chery group models, such as the Omoda 9 and Chery Tiggo 9.

The powertrain consists of a 1.5-litre turbocharged petrol engine and a three-speed automatic gearbox, sending 422bhp and 427lb ft of torque through both axles.

This gives the 8 a 0-62mph time of 5.8sec – very nearly as quick as the Volkswagen Golf GTI.

It has a combined range of more than 700 miles and an electric-only range of 83 miles, while DC fast-charging capability of up to 40kW allows for a 30-80% charge in around 20 minutes.

Some other Chery group SUVs are offered with pure-ICE and electric power, but Autocar understands that an EV variant of the 8 isn't currently planned, and while an entry-level petrol variant is available in other right-hand-drive markets (with a 2.0-litre four-cylinder turbo engine that makes 245bhp and 284lb ft), there are no plans to bring it here.

The Luxury model features seven seats, making the 8 the first Jaecoo model offered in the UK to feature a three-row layout. 

Meanwhile, the Executive maintains a third row of seating but with a six-seat layout made up of four extendable ‘captain’s chairs’ upholstered in Nappa leather.

Dual 12.3in displays, a Sony 14-speaker sound system, w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to and heated, ventilated and massaging front seats are all standard.

Autocar understands that the 8 isn’t an attempt to distance Jaecoo away from the value segment but rather a further addition to the range in response to market and customer feedback.
